Fitting an orangery on your residential home normally takes a few days to a week to complete. The skilled installer in East Sussex/England will take any needs and wants, assist you to decide on a model and supply and set up the orangery. The professional will also be conscious of the Building Regulations necessary and you’ll only have to apply for planning permission.
With an all new orangery you’ll straightaway have more room for your home which is just the thing for a growing family. With house fees on the rise this is actually the most viable strategy for putting in additional room and differs from the more typical conservatories.

Lewes is the county town of the administrative county of East Sussex in England. It is a civil parish and it is the centre of the Lewes local government district. In accordance with the 2001 Census, it has a population of around 15988 and an area of 4.4 square miles. Traditionally, the town has been recognised as a bridging point and a market town, and it is mostly viewed as a communications and tourist-oriented town in the present day as a result of the countless historical landmarks. The historical pattern of the streets continues to exist, including a substantial number of mediaeval structure plots and oak framed homes, such as The Fifteenth Century Bookshop situated on the High Street. The service sectors are the biggest employers to a significant extent, with over 60 percent of the population employed in that sector in 2001. Although, the town continues to be honoured as one of England’s finest manufacturers of ale, with beers, wines and spirits continuing to be distributed from Lewes under the ‘Harveys’ name ever since 1794. An occasion with particular value for the town is the Lewes Bonfire celebrations occurring on Fifth November, Guy Fawkes Night. Not only does this remember the date of the unmasking of the Gunpowder Plot in 1605, the date is also important for the town as a celebration for the 17 Protestant martyrs burnt at the stake for their faith during the course of the Marian Persecutions. The contentious celebration which constitutes the burning of an effigy of Pope Paul V, the pope during the time of the martyrdoms, are the greatest and most renowned bonfire night celebrations in England.
